LPGA: Minjee Lee achieves victory

Leading in each of the second and third rounds of the Cognizant Founders Cup, Australia's Minjee Lee maintained her lead in the final round on Sunday in Clifton, New Jersey, to win the LPGA event.

The winner was not out of harm's way throughout her final outing at Upper Montclair Country Club, however, as she bogeyed on her front nine, allowing her opponents to come back at the height of the race. . However, she managed three birdies on the back nine. She thus beat the American Lexi Thompson by two strokes.

Quebecer Maude-Aimée Leblanc was one of the two representatives of the maple leaf in the running at the start of the tournament, along with Maddie Szeryk. However, neither was able to qualify for the weekend rounds.
